2 ways friction is helpful and 2 ways it does not

Answers

Benefits of friction.

1. Walking. Friction between the soles of our  shoes and the ground enables us to walk. The sole of the shoe is held to the ground through friction. This is what is termed as "grip" of the shoe. The more grip a shoes offers, the better and faster we can walk.

2. Writing. Writing using a pen requires friction. It is impossible to hold a pen in the hand without friction because it would slip out. Also the graphite point of the pencil would not make a mark on the paper without friction.

Drawbacks of friction

1. Drag. An aircraft taking off experiences significant friction between it and the air resulting in drag, so much fuel has to be used to  create energy to overcome the wind resistance.

2. Surface hindrance. Friction makes moving something heavy from  one part of a room to another very difficult. Sliding a large box across the flour takes a lot of energy due to friction between the box and the floor.

This runner completed a 100 meter race with a time of 13.75 seconds. what was her average speed

Answers

Taking into account the definition of speed, you get that the average speed of the runner is 7.27 (m)/(s).

It is necessary to know that speed ​​is a physical quantity that expresses the relationship between the space traveled by an object and the time used for it.

In other words, speed can be defined as the amount of space traveled per unit of time with which a body moves and can be calculated using the expression:

Speed= (distance traveled)/(time)

In this case:

  • distance traveled= 100 meters
  • time= 13.75 seconds

Replacing these values ​​in the speed definition:

Speed= (100 m)/(13.75 s)

Solving:

Speed= 7.27 (m)/(s)

In summary, the average speed of the runner is 7.27 (m)/(s).

What is a beaker? can you also post a picture of what it ;looks like for me?

Answers

It's a piece of glassware used for handling liquids, usually in a laboratory,
although I use one as a coffee cup.

They have markings on the side, like a kitchen measuring cup, so you can
measure different amounts of liquid, and they have a lip for pouring.

They're also usually made of a special type of glass (borosilicate) so that
they won't crack when very hot liquids are poured in.
